ACCREDITATION OF ESAMI MBA
ESAMI is an intergovernmental Organization owned by 10 member states. All the countries (Kenya, Mozambique, Malawi, Namibia, Tanzania, Uganda, Seychelles, Swaziland, Zambia and Zimbabwe) signed the Charter establishing ESAMI in October 1979. This Charter was endorsed by the Executive Secretary of the United Nations Economic Commission for Africa (UNECA).
This Charter stipulates that one of the Institute functions is to “offer appropriate examination courses and certification in management fields. Pursuant to this function, the Governing Board of ESAMI comprising Permanent/Principal Secretaries of the 10 member states caused an independent study on the capacity and capability of ESAMI to perform this function to be undertaken. Having satisfied themselves as to ESAMI’s capacity and capability, the Governing Board granted a Charter to award degrees on the 17th November 1998. Subsequently, ESAMI commenced MBA programme in February 1999. To date, all 10 member states have recognized and accredited the ESAMI MBA. These countries include Tanzania, Kenya, Uganda, Namibia, Zambia, Malawi, Seychelles, Swaziland, Mozambique and Zimbabwe.
